asked 12/14/20The angle of elevation to the top of a Building in New York is found to be 4 degrees from the ground at a distance of 2 miles from the base of the building. Using this information, find the height of the building. Round to the tenths. Hint: 1 mile = 5280 feet
Your answer is ____ feet

Well height/distance = tan 4°
So height in miles = 2 tan 4°, so height in feet = 2 x 5280 x tan 4°
(make sure your calculator is set to degrees not radians)
